Output d63fb062e8b0229981ca4e52d4e7f711c587ad69bc7868e903ada70b2ce81108:6

value
29780000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b7b9e58c34c599c0c6b0030787b790ec7551f4e OP_EQUALVERIFY OP_CHECKSIG
address
16RWxV861fTUJpZV1KNhvYEbi4dRTtMkJM
transaction
d63fb062e8b0229981ca4e52d4e7f711c587ad69bc7868e903ada70b2ce81108
spent
true